Reading of Lucretius' De Rerum Natura

Explore the depths of ancient Roman thought with Reading of Lucretius' De Rerum Natura by Lee Fratantuono, published by Bloomsbury Publishing Plc in 2017. This insightful commentary spans 518 pages, providing readers with a thorough analysis of Lucretius' monumental work, the earliest surviving epic poem from ancient Rome.

Fratantuono expertly unpacks the themes and philosophical ideas presented in De Rerum Natura, making it accessible to both new readers and seasoned scholars. His profound insights offer a unique perspective on the historical and literary significance of Lucretius' writing, while illuminating its relevance in contemporary discussions of philosophy and poetry.
